En vrac’ rapide et libre.

Comme j’ai un manque d’envie en ce moment coté article de fond sur le logiciel libre, voici un petit en vrac’ pour compenser.

Bon, c’est tout pour aujourd’hui. Je retourne à ma kindle, objet honni par certains libristes qui seraient comme des végétariens se léchant les babines devant un steak saignant

GNU/Linux n’arrivant pas à s’imposer sur le bureau, est-ce un mal ?

Cette semaine, l’actualité GNU/linuxienne a été assez chargée. Entre l’abandon d’un greffon flash après la sortie d’Adobe Flash 11.2 (officiellement supportée durant 5 ans), l’annonce comme quoi CUPS abandonnerait certaines fonctions typiquement attachée à GNU/Linux, même si elles seront compensées par l’utilisation de technologie comme Avahi, on ne peut pas dire qu’elle soit joyeuse. Ah, si, ComiceOS, le clone plus ou moins bien réussi de MacOS-X basé sur une ubuntu est retourné à ses chères études et retourne à son vrai niveau technique, une béta mal dégrossie.

J’ai déjà abordé plusieurs fois ce sujet, dont ce billet d’octobre dernier. Cependant, Une raison que je n’avais pas abordé, c’est simplement que pour s’imposer un minimum sur le marché de l’environnement de bureau, il faut une unification intégrale, ce qui reviendrait à imposer au minimum :

  • Une seule interface graphique utilisateur
  • Un seul ensemble de logiciels bureautiques et d’outils en rapport avec l’internet
  • Un seul format de paquets, et d’outil pour ajouter des logiciels tiers

Bref, une seule distribution pour tout le monde. C’est le pari risqué de Canonical, risqué car c’est rajouté dessus la volonté de faire une interface graphique utilisateur qui malgré ses qualités et ses défauts n’arrive au final qu’à faire une chose : entraîner dans une partie de la communauté du logiciel libre et des distributions GNU/Linux un rejet limite viscéral.

Car, et je le répèterais jusqu’à ce que le message soit bien passé, le logiciel libre, c’est le monde du choix. Choisir son noyau (LTS ou « normal »), son format de paquets (rpm, deb, ou un format à la slackware / ArchLinux / Frugalware Linux, etc…), l’interface graphique que l’on préfère (Gnome, Kde, Xfce, RatPoison, WindowMaker, OpenBox, Lxde, Unity, etc…), son navigateur internet, sa trousse bureautique, etc…

On ne peut que saluer l’effort, que je considère comme vain et énergivore, de Canonical et de sa volonté d’imposer un environnement type unifié et unique.

Si un jour cela doit arriver, ce ne sera pas par la pression d’un acteur aussi puissant soit-il, mais par la volonté de la communauté de montrer ce qu’elle sait faire.

Car le monde GNU/Linux est avant tout communautaire, au sens noble du terme. Je vais donc finir ce court billet en citant un article que j’ai rédigé début janvier 2012 :

Mis à part Ubuntu, Fedora Linux (indirectement) et OpenSuSE, le reste est occupé par des distributions communautaires ou de type communautaire. D’ailleurs, cette année, la distribution communautaire ArchLinux fête ses 10 ans, Debian GNU/Linux ses… 19 ans ! CentOS ? 8 ans cette année.
[…]
Une distribution communautaire dépend des dons de ses utilisateurs, que ce soit en terme purement technique ou financier. Demander des fonds pour se financer, est-ce si grave ? Poser la question, n’est-ce pas y répondre ?

D’ailleurs, selon moi, une distribution communautaire aura, la plupart du temps, les reins plus solides qu’une distribution adossée à une entreprise. Pour une simple et bonne raison : pas d’actionnaires à qui verser des dividendes. Ce qui aide à la survie d’une distribution, même si des appels à donner arrive de temps à autres.

Bon samedi 😀

KDE SC 4.8 : un grand cru de l’environnement de bureau.

Dans une vie précédente, j’ai utilisé KDE 4.3, ce qui remonte à environ 2 ans et demi. J’avoue que je n’ai pas eu envie de me plonger dans KDE entre temps, mais la sortie de la version de KDE SC 4.8 m’a donné envie de le faire. J’ai donc installé dans une machine virtuelle Qemu-KVM, une distribution archlinux 64 bits.

Au moment où je rédige cet article, KDE SC 4.8.0 est encore dans le dépot [testing] de la distribution, et donc demande l’activation de ce dernier. Pour l’installation, je n’ai pas cherché la finesse : bien qu’il existe un découpage en méta-paquets, j’ai demandé l’installation de la totalité de l’environnement, ce qui a demandé quelque chose comme 2 Go ? 😉

Installation de KDE SC 4.8

L’installation s’est résumé à faire un :


yaourt -S kde

La traduction française ?


yaourt -S kde-l10n-fr

J’ai ensuite rajouter une extension qui permet d’utiliser le moteur webkit en lieu et place de khtml dans konqueror.


yaourt -S kwebkitpart

Une fois l’ensemble lancé, est on surpris par la légèreté de l’affichage. La barre des tâches qui contient le menu K est joliment stylisé. Le bouton qui permet de gérer les gadgets est simple, loin du clinquant de l’époque KDE 4.2 / 4.3.

Continuer la lecture de « KDE SC 4.8 : un grand cru de l’environnement de bureau. »

Les distributions n’aiment pas la simplicité…

…Ou n’aiment pas le « one size fits all » ? Un fidèle lecteur m’a écrit il y a quelques jours pour me suggérer de parler d’un problème inhérent selon lui aux distributions linux : leur rejet de la simplicité.

Je ne reproduirais pas le message en question, mais tout ce que je peux dire, c’est que cette personne a une dent contre les interfaces qui se démultiplient, spécialement les interfaces nouvelles générations qui ont fait leurs premières armes l’année dernière.

Un reproche que l’on fait souvent aux interfaces graphiques utilisateurs des distributions linux, c’est leur foisonnement. Contrairement au duopole Microsoft-Apple où chacun des adversaires impose sa vision de l’interface graphique comme étant ce que recherche l’utilisateur (en lui imposant au passage sa vision des choses), le monde du logiciel libre est celui qui refuse l’idée de la taille unique, en clair imposer à l’utilisateur débutant comme à l’habitué la même interface, avec les mêmes icones, les mêmes raccourcis claviers, etc…

D’un coté on impose l’interface, et l’utilisateur fait son choix souvent en fonction de ses besoins ou de ses finances, de l’autre, on laisse l’utilisateur choisir ce qui lui convient le mieux à l’utilisation.

C’est pour cela que l’on a 3 grands noms dans les environnements de bureau, Gnome, KDE SC et Xfce, mais aussi un nombre conséquent de gestionnaires de fenêtres plus ou moins complet, allant d’Openbox à RatPoison, en passant par fluxbox, windowmaker ou encore wmfs.

Ce n’est pas que les distributions refusent la simplicité, elle préfère promouvoir un ou plusieurs choix (en fonction de la cible d’utilisateurs qu’elles visent), car tout le monde n’a pas les mêmes besoins, ni les mêmes envies.

Dans ce cas, les distributions les plus ouvertes sont, par ordre alphabétique : Archlinux, Crux Debian, Fedora, Frugalware, Funtoo, Gentoo.

Car soit elles ne mettent en avant aucune interface, soit elles proposent les principales individuellement.

Choisir pour l’utilisateur ou laisser l’utilisateur choisir, à vous de voir la voie que vous préférez !

Quelques anniversaires pour 2012…

Comme chaque année, nous allons cette année fêter les 5ième, 10ième, 15ième, 20ième anniversaires de projets informatiques célèbres. Liste non exhaustive, bien entendu 😉

Pour les 5 ans ?

Pour les 10 ans ?

  • Mars : sortie d’une distribution du nom… d’ArchLinux 0.1, nom de code Homer 🙂
  • Avril : Sortie de l’environnement KDE 3.x, dont l’ultime version 3.5.10 est sorti en 2008.
  • Juin : sortie de la Suite Mozilla 1.0, fruit de 4 ans de travail, depuis l’ouverture du code de Netscape Communicator en mars 1998. et aussi, sortie de l’environnement Gnome 2.0, dont l’ultime version a été la 2.32, 8 ans plus tard.
  • Juillet : Sortie de la Debian GNU/Linux 3.0, alias Woody
  • Août : Ultime version 4.x de Netscape Communicator, la 4.8…
  • Septembre : Netscape 7.0 sort, basé sur le code de Mozilla 1.0 et sortie d’un petit projet porté par Dave Hyatt, Joe Hewitt et Blake Ross, du nom de Phoenix 0.1 sort… Et est connu sous le nom d’un certain… Mozilla Firefox 😉

Et un anniversaire symbolique, celui de l’offre de Free qui a cassé les prix de l’internet en France… Une vidéo pour la mémoire 🙂

Pour les 15 ans ?

Pour les 20 ans ?

  • Mars ou Avril : les 20 ans d’un autre Microsoft Windows… Le premier à avoir vraiment du succès, la version 3.1 !
  • Mai 1992 : une petite boite du nom d’Id Software pose la première pierre à une révolution à venir. Préparez vos estomacs, Wolfenstein 3D sort.

Désolé pour les oublis, mais déjà une telle liste est intéressante. Et j’oubliais : meilleurs voeux pour 2012 !

Quand Frugalware rentre dans la cour des grands…

Quel est le point commun entre : Ubuntu, Linux Mint, Fedora, OpenSuSE, Debian GNU/linux, Puppy et Mageïa ? Mis à part d’être dans le top 10 de Distrowatch ? Proposer des versions Live de leur distribution.

C’est dans le but d’accroitre sa popularité que l’équipe de Frugalware nous propose à son tour une série de LiveCD / DVD installable et hybride.

Même si le projet ne sera vraiment mature que pour la sortie de la version 1.6 de la distribution (donc pour le 13 février prochain), c’est déjà agréable d’avoir un aperçu de ce qu’on peut avoir installé 🙂

Continuer la lecture de « Quand Frugalware rentre dans la cour des grands… »

Bilan de 2011 pour Archlinux.

L’année 2011 est bientôt finie, et comme pour d’autres distributions, cette année aura été riche en évènement. Et c’est aussi un article clin d’oeil au diablotin, célèbre mainteneur de la distribution Frugalware Linux qui est une de mes distributions chouchoute 🙂

Le plus important, c’est la sortie de plusieurs ISO d’installation non officielles et une ISO officielle très attendue, en août dernier.

Il faut dire l’ISO précédente datait de plus d’an, de mai 2010. Et vu l’évolution rapide du projet, autant dire que cela faisait une petite éternité.

Coté grand évènement, c’est l’arrivée sur le dépot testing – et l’année prochaine sur la version stable – d’un pacman qui gère les signatures de paquets.

Et parmi les autres évolutions de 2011 ? La gestion automatisée des modules ainsi qu’une gestion différente de leur mise sur liste noire, est celle qui me vient à l’esprit.

Ce qui m’a fait aussi plaisir, c’est la transition sans encombre vers le noyau linux 3.0, ou encore la possibilité de voir arriver la nouvelle génération de Gnome, génération décriée à cause de son ergonomie complètement différente par rapport à la génération précédente qui avait vu le jour en 2002.

Ce qui a marqué l’année, c’est aussi la popularité croissante d’Archlinux. Et même si ces statistiques ne valent pas grand chose, sur les 12 derniers mois, Archlinux est à la 6ième place du top de pages vues quotidiennement sur Distrowatch, contre 9ième un an plus tôt.

D’ailleurs, le nombre de distributions dérivées d’Archlinux ne cesse de croitre (liste non exhaustive), même si on est loin de ce qui se passe avec Ubuntu…

Espérons que 2012 soit une grande année pour les distributions rolling release, aussi bien pour ArchLinux adorée que pour ma chouchoute, la Frugalware Linux.

Mandriva 2011 : Retour aux racines de la distribution ?

Souvenez-vous…

Nous sommes en 1998. La distribution RedHat Linux en version 5.1 propose alors un noyau linux 2.0.34. Cependant, elle a un défaut aux yeux de certains utilisateurs… Ne pas proposer KDE 1.0. il est vrai que KDE 1.0 sort en juillet 1998 et que la RedHat 5.1 est sortie quelque mois plus tôt. Pour éviter d’attendre, des personnes prennent la RedHat et lui rajoute KDE 1.0… Mandrake Linux 5.1 est née !

13 ans sont passés, et après bien des péripéties, voici donc arrivée la version 2011 de la Mandriva. Après avoir récupéré l’image ISO, et pour éviter des problèmes d’affichage avec KDE, j’ai installé le tout dans une machine virtuelle VirtualBox.

Et coté retour aux racines, c’est clair : KDE ou aucun autre environnement. Gnome, Xfce et compagnie sont dépréciés. Autant dire qu’il faut aimer KDE pour utiliser la distribution. Au moins, cela a le mérite d’être clair.

Sur les premières impressions : on sent que pas mal de boulot a été effectué sur la distribution : c’est rapide au démarrage (merci systemd), le nettoyage a été profond et les outils semblent avoir été revu dans un sens d’utilisation simplifié.

Dès l’écran de connexion, on se retrouve en face d’un écran qui fait penser à ce qu’on trouve partout ailleurs : une image de connexion avec une boite de saisie pour le mot de passe. Et un gros morceau a été rajouté, aimablement inspiré par la vue Applications de Gnome 3 ou encore ce qui est disponible dans l’outil de Canonical, Unity. Un panneau d’application un peu fourre tout mais bien pensé, qui remplace le menu « K » qu’on trouve habituellement. Une vidéo sera plus parlante pour montrer un peu la Mandriva 2011 en action.

Pour faire un rapide bilan de la distribution, ce que l’on peut dire…

En positif :

  • Rapide, rapide, ai-je dit rapide ?
  • Les outils sont allégés
  • Le menu « SimpleWelcome » permet de trouver facilement ses petits
  • Les menus systèmes bien rangés.

En négatif :

  • Un seul environnement de bureau
  • Parfois des outils systèmes redondants
  • Arrivée un peu tardive

Maintenant, à vous de tester et de voir si cette distribution vous parle ou pas !

Chakra GNU/Linux 2011.04 : une nouvelle version d’une Archlinux KDEisée.

Je reviens donc après une courte pause qui m’a fait beaucoup de bien 😉

J’ai déjà parlé de Chakra GNU/Linux plusieurs fois sur le blog. J’ai donc profité de la sortie de cette nouvelle version « stable » pour installer l’ensemble dans une machine virtuelle.

J’ai donc récupéré l’image ISO du DVD en 64 bits.

[fred@fredo-arch ISO à tester]$ wget -c http://downloads.sourceforge.net/project/chakra/current-release/images/chakra-dvd-2011.04-kde462-x86_64.iso
–2011-05-05 09:15:55– http://downloads.sourceforge.net/project/chakra/current-release/images/chakra-dvd-2011.04-kde462-x86_64.iso
Résolution de downloads.sourceforge.net… 216.34.181.59
Connexion vers downloads.sourceforge.net|216.34.181.59|:80…connecté.
requête HTTP transmise, en attente de la réponse…302 Found
Emplacement: http://netcologne.dl.sourceforge.net/project/chakra/current-release/images/chakra-dvd-2011.04-kde462-x86_64.iso [suivant]
–2011-05-05 09:15:56– http://netcologne.dl.sourceforge.net/project/chakra/current-release/images/chakra-dvd-2011.04-kde462-x86_64.iso
Résolution de netcologne.dl.sourceforge.net… 78.35.24.46, 2001:4dd0:1234:6::5f
Connexion vers netcologne.dl.sourceforge.net|78.35.24.46|:80…connecté.
requête HTTP transmise, en attente de la réponse…200 OK
Longueur: 1379926016 (1,3G) [application/x-iso9660-image]
Sauvegarde en : «chakra-dvd-2011.04-kde462-x86_64.iso»

100%[====================================>] 1 379 926 016 923K/s ds 21m 35s

2011-05-05 09:37:31 (1,02 MB/s) – «chakra-dvd-2011.04-kde462-x86_64.iso» sauvegardé [1379926016/1379926016]

Terminé –2011-05-05 09:37:31–
Téléchargé(s): 1 fichiers, 1,3G en 21m 35s (1,02 MB/s)

Ensuite, j’ai lancé la machine virtuelle habituelle, sauf que j’ai légèrement modifié les options utilisées pour configurer la machine virtuelle. J’ai rajouté l’option « -vga vmware », ce qui permet de contourner un bug de kde (ou de qemu ?) qui rend l’affichage en 24 bits assez « sale ».


[fred@fredo-arch ISO à tester]$ qemu-img create -f qed disk.img 32G
Formatting 'disk.img', fmt=qed size=34359738368 cluster_size=0 table_size=0
[fred@fredo-arch ISO à tester]$ kvm64 -hda disk.img -cdrom chakra-dvd-2011.04-kde462-x86_64.iso -vga vmware -boot cd &

J’ai lancé ensuite l’installation en utilisant le noyau non-LTS. Par défaut, le DVD propose le noyau LTS et un non-LTS. Et installe aussi les deux.

Continuer la lecture de « Chakra GNU/Linux 2011.04 : une nouvelle version d’une Archlinux KDEisée. »

Mageia – alpha 1 : le fork de Mandriva en plein réveil !

Tel le docteur Frankenstein branchant l’électricité pour donner vie à sa créature, l’annonce de la sortie de la première alpha du fork communautaire de Mandriva fait plaisir à lire.

Même s’il est précisé en gros, gras et large que c’est une préversion, nullement finie, et d’abord destinée au contributeurs de la communauté Mageia, c’est toujours une occasion pour faire une présentation rapide de la distribution qui a pour ambition de sortir sa première version « finale » en juin 2011.

J’ai donc utilisé mon ami wget pour récupérer l’image ISO de la version 64 Bits. Avec une lenteur qui est digne d’une tortue rhumatisante n’ayant que 3 pattes 🙁

[fred@fredo-arch ISO à tester]$ wget -c http://ftp.mandrivauser.de/mirrors/Mageia/iso/cauldron/mageia-dvd-1-x86_64.iso
–2011-02-15 09:15:16– http://ftp.mandrivauser.de/mirrors/Mageia/iso/cauldron/mageia-dvd-1-x86_64.iso
Résolution de ftp.mandrivauser.de… 62.141.52.97
Connexion vers ftp.mandrivauser.de|62.141.52.97|:80…connecté.
requête HTTP transmise, en attente de la réponse…200 OK
Longueur: 2051014656 (1,9G) [application/x-iso9660-image]
Sauvegarde en : «mageia-dvd-1-x86_64.iso»

100%[====================================>] 2 051 014 656 132K/s ds 3h 55m

2011-02-15 13:11:13 (141 KB/s) – «mageia-dvd-1-x86_64.iso» sauvegardé [2051014656/2051014656]

J’ai ensuite récupéré un disque virtuel de 32 Go, et j’ai lancé la commande magique :


[fred@fredo-arch ISO à tester]$ kvm64 -hda disk.img -cdrom mageia-dvd-1-x86_64.iso -boot d &

Manque de chance, l’image se vautre dès le démarrage. Peut-être un bug de kvm-git ?

Je dois donc me reporter sur VirtualBox… Et tout se lance normalement !

Continuer la lecture de « Mageia – alpha 1 : le fork de Mandriva en plein réveil ! »